MS himself has declared that this is the ‘last phase’ of his career, but neither Dhoni and CSK have confirmed this officially.
Danny Morrison asked MS the following question at the toss of the IPL 2023 match against Lucknow Super Giants in Lucknow: Clearly this wonderful swansong tour, your last. How are you enjoying it?
Ms Dhoni Replay to Danny Morrison
MS Replay: You have decided it is my last (smiles). Not me. It’s under covers and it looks tacky, so we’ll look to bowl first. You have to see all conditions and venue conditions. For us, Deepak Chahar is fit, so he replaces Akash (Singh).
KL Rahul Injury
KL Rahul, the regular captain, is out of action with a serious thigh injury, so LSG all-rounder Krunal Padya is currently leading the side. The captain of CSK, MS won the toss and decided to bowl first against Lucknow Super Giants.
But due to rain, the match could not be completed and both the teams got one point each.
